- Tools to Enhance Your Guitar Playing Experience

As a beginner guitar player, there are a few essential accessories that can greatly enhance your playing experience. These tools are designed to make the learning process easier and more enjoyable, helping you to develop your skills and make progress faster. In this article, we will explore some of the most important guitar accessories that every beginner needs to have in their arsenal.

1. Tuner: One of the most important accessories for any guitar player, a tuner ensures that your instrument is always in tune. This is crucial for producing clear, accurate sounds and developing your ear for pitch. There are many different types of tuners available, from clip-on tuners that attach to the headstock of your guitar to pedal tuners that sit on the floor. Whichever type you choose, make sure it is easy to use and accurate.

2. Guitar Strap: A guitar strap is essential for playing while standing up, as it allows you to hold the instrument securely in place. This is especially important for beginners who may not be used to holding a guitar for long periods of time. Look for a strap that is adjustable and comfortable, as you will be wearing it for extended periods of time during practice sessions and performances.

3. Capo: A capo is a small device that clamps onto the neck of the guitar, allowing you to change the pitch of the instrument without changing the fingering of the chords. This can be extremely useful for beginners who are still learning to play and may not be comfortable with more complex chord shapes. A capo can also be used to play songs in different keys, making it a versatile tool for any guitarist.

4. Picks: Picks, also known as plectrums, are small pieces of plastic or metal that are used to strum or pick the strings of the guitar. They come in a variety of shapes and thicknesses, each producing a different tone and feel. As a beginner, it is important to experiment with different picks to find the one that works best for your playing style. Some guitarists prefer thicker picks for a more aggressive sound, while others prefer thinner picks for a lighter touch.

5. Gig Bag: A gig bag is essential for transporting your guitar safely to and from practice sessions, lessons, and performances. Look for a bag that is padded and water-resistant to protect your instrument from damage. Some gig bags also come with additional pockets for storing accessories such as picks, strings, and tuners, making it easier to keep everything organized and easily accessible.

6. Guitar Stand: A guitar stand is a convenient way to store your instrument when you are not playing it. This helps to protect the guitar from damage and ensures that it is always ready to pick up and play. Look for a stand that is sturdy and adjustable to accommodate different sizes and shapes of guitars.

In conclusion, these essential guitar accessories are designed to enhance your playing experience as a beginner. By investing in high-quality tools such as a tuner, guitar strap, capo, picks, gig bag, and guitar stand, you can improve your skills, protect your instrument, and make the learning process more enjoyable.
